On Friday 19th September, Thomas Adams School proudly hosted the second Trust Music Event, welcoming pupils and staff from Hodnet Primary School and The Priory School.

Throughout the day, talented instrumentalists from across The 3-18 Education Trust worked together to learn and rehearse five musical pieces, culminating in a memorable performance as a massed orchestra. It was inspiring to see students of all ages – from primary through to sixth form – collaborating, supporting one another, and sharing their love of music.

The event was attended by Claire Jones, Deputy CEO of The 3-18 Education Trust and Thomas Adams Headteacher, Mr Mark Cooper, who both had the opportunity to watch the performance and speak to students about their experience.

The day was a true celebration of music highlighting the exceptional talent and enthusiasm of pupils across the Trust.
